Editorial nomination

Featuring is the single biggest free discovery lever there is — up to 5–10× installs the week it runs, and that velocity lifts organic rank for weeks. But today it's an invisible internal process. Editorial nomination opens the door — for proven, quality apps that self-nominate, qualify, and can track their application.

What it is
In-Partner-Center nomination + a published eligibility checklist (rating, crash-free %, localisation, freshness) + status tracking.
The magic
Featuring drives 5–10× installs the week it runs (Apple) / 2–6× (Google) — and lifts organic rank for weeks after.
How it helps discovery
Turns featuring from a black box into something you can apply for, qualify for, and track — plus a campaign-ID so you finally see which rail drove your installs.
Who it's for
Proven, quality apps with real momentum — not the mega-brands (they already have Spotlight), not unproven new apps (a weak pick corrupts the shelf).
